The Mechanism of Botox
Botox, medically known as botulinum toxin, is derived from a bacterium called Clostridium botulinum. While it originated from a toxin, researchers have harnessed its properties to safely and effectively address cosmetic concerns. Botox targets the nervous system; more specifically, it blocks the release of acetylcholine, a neurotransmitter responsible for muscle contraction.
When a small, controlled dose of Botox is injected into specific facial muscles, it inhibits the nerve signals that trigger muscle contractions. This temporary paralysis relaxes wrinkles and fine lines, resulting in a smoother appearance. How Botox is Applied
The application of Botox is a precise process that requires a trained healthcare professional to ensure safety and desired outcomes. The journey begins with a comprehensive consultation, during which the patient’s goals and medical history are assessed. Understanding the facial anatomy is crucial, as it allows the practitioner to identify target areas for injection.
Once the target muscles are identified, the practitioner uses fine needles to inject the Botox directly into these areas. This minimally invasive procedure usually takes less than 30 minutes, allowing patients to resume their daily activities immediately. Knowing the optimal dosage and injection technique is key to preventing over or under-treatment.

Duration and Maintenance
The effects of Botox are not permanent, which means recurring treatments are necessary to maintain results. Typically, the smoothing effects can be seen within a few days post-injection, with full results visible by the two-week mark. On average, the effects of a Botox treatment last between three to six months.
Individuals often schedule follow-up appointments for ongoing smoothness to ensure minimal lapse in muscle relaxation. With regular treatments, some find they can extend the time between sessions as their muscles gradually adapt to reduced activity. Each session should be tailored to the patient to prevent muscle atrophy or other adverse effects.
Safety and Efficacy
Botox is well-regarded for its safety when administered by a trained and experienced professional. While potential side effects like bruising or minor swelling can occur, serious complications are rare. Following post-treatment guidelines, such as avoiding strenuous activities and keeping the head upright, can mitigate risks.
Its efficacy is backed by numerous clinical studies and satisfied patients who continue to choose Botox for their aesthetic goals. The assurance of predictable outcomes makes Botox a staple in cosmetic dermatology. Nevertheless, candid conversations with healthcare providers ensure patients have realistic expectations and understand the procedure’s limitations and benefits.
